About Floor & Decor Holdings, Inc.
Floor & Decor is a multi-channel specialty retailer and commercial flooring distributor operating more than 200 warehouse-format stores and five design studios across 36 states. The Company offers a broad assortment of in-stock hard-surface flooring, including tile, wood, laminate, vinyl, and natural stone along with decorative accessories and wall tile, installation materials, and adjacent categories at everyday low prices. The Company was founded in 2000 and is head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ia.
